London: A 300-year-old remarkably well-preserved shoe has been found in the wall of a University of Cambridge building in the UK that was likely put there to bring luck and ward off evil spirits.

The venerable footwear was uncovered by maintenance staff of the St John's College while they were removing panels to install electrical cables a common room for senior academics. The building was originally the residence of the Master of the College.
